About the Role
This role provides customer-focused services and community-led support which responds to the diverse needs of the community, and increases the awareness of, and engagement with community hub services including library. Right now, we have a great permanent opportunity at Wainuiomata Neighbourhood Hub - working the following shift pattern:
Tuesday to Saturday:
- 9.15am - 5.45pm weekdays
- 8.45am - 5.15pm Saturday
You will be working at the Wainuiomata Neighbourhood Hub. However, you may be required to work in one of our other Lower Hutt based Hubs on occasion.
About You
We are seeking an innovative, community-focused librarian with a positive, can-do attitude and a genuine passion for delivering exceptional library programmes and hub services. You will bring an outstanding commitment to customer service and a strong community-led development ethos, working collaboratively with people of all ages and backgrounds across our diverse community.
Ideally, you will hold a library qualification or have experience in a related field such as community library services, customer engagement, readers' advisory, programme development and delivery & digital literacy. Leadership experience, knowledge of adult and children's learning, literacy initiatives, and experience working with Rangatahi will be highly valued.
